Sonterra tests Matagorda wells

HOUSTON: Sonterra Resources and STO Operating Co., a subsidiary of South Texas Oil Co., have completed and tested the State Tract 127-1 Unit Well in Matagorda Bay offshore Texas, and plans to bring it on line in the Nodosaria-1 formation at 11,700 feet (3,556 m) by the end of January.


The well reached a total depth of 12,464 feet (3,799 m) in August 2008. Well log analysis indicated multiple oil and gas pay zones in the Bolmex and Nodosaria-1 formations between 8,500 feet (2,591 m) and 11,700 feet (3,556 m).Sonterra Resources' Matagorda Bay State Tract 150-1 ST No. 1 well, a sidetrack development well, has reached total depth of 10,246 feet (3,122 m) and been cased and cemented. Well log analysis indicates multiple gas and condensate pay zones in the Bolmex formation at depths between 9,300 feet (2,834 m) and 10,000 feet (3,048 m). The well tested 785 Mcf/d of gas, 120 b/d of condensate and 67 b/d of completion fluid water. Sonterra Resources expects to bring the well on line in early January at 9,950 feet (3,032 m).
